The Killers are a stadium-filling rock powerhouse from Las Vegas, known for their anthemic sound, cinematic storytelling, and commanding stage presence. Bursting onto the global scene with their landmark debut Hot Fuss, featuring chart-topping hits like Mr. Brightside” and “Somebody Told Me,” the band quickly became one of the defining voices of 21st-century rock. Their signature blend of heartland rock, new wave, and indie influences has carried through acclaimed albums including Sam’s Town, Battle Born, and Pressure Machine.
